Need help on blocking adult content
 
I cant seem to stop the adult content files from showing up in my searches. I have 2 teenaged nephews that are on my pc alot and I dont want them being subjected to this. I have tried going into "tools" and "filters" like the instructions have told me to do and entering the keywords I want blocked, but if you search for adult videos they still appear. Is there any way to stop the porn completely? This is frustrating!!! They really enjoy making CD's and I dont want to cancel LimeWire but I dont want their parents killing me either. Can anyone help????

Kristina

There is no way to stop the industrious teenage boy (or boys) from finding porn using Limewire, the only real way is supervision.

And, in future, do not put you full name in an open (world-wide) forum, there are a lot of "not-so-nice" people out there just itching to get into someone's life.
